I'm so jazzed up after reading the interview with Baron, I can't resist posting a chunk of it here for those who don't feel like clicking (apologies to the powers that be if it's too big of a chunk):

ESPN: Are we finally going to see the Warriors in the playoffs?

Baron: Yes, sir. Yes, sir. Yes, sir. We're feeling good. The spirit of the team is on a high level. The [remaining] schedule, it's a hard schedule, but it's going to be fun. If we just continue playing the way we've been playing, I think we're going to be there.

ESPN: You said earlier in the season that the Warriors were fooling themselves to even think about the playoffs until they started winning more road games. Your team still isn't winning on the road, so how are you still in the hunt for the No. 8 spot?

Baron: I'm very surprised [Golden State's road struggles] haven't hurt us more. But recently, I think we've been playing better on the road now that we've finally got our whole team healthy.

ESPN: What have Al Harrington and Stephen Jackson brought to the team?

Baron: An attitude and a passion for the game. They also bring camaraderie. Guys are hanging out together, we're doing a lot of team stuff. We weren't doing that before.

ESPN: The Warriors have four straight wins over the Dallas Mavericks. Do you really think you have their number and can give them a series?

Baron: Yes. It's been a good matchup for us. We've got a lot of athletic guys at 6-6 and 6-7 to throw at them. Plus having Coach Nelson, he's coached a lot of those Dallas players. So that's the X-factor.
